Which magazines publish political cartoons?
Among the magazines that commonly publish political cartoons are MAD Magazine and The Economist. MAD Magazine is known for its humorous and irreverent takes on politics, while The Economist offers more serious and analytical cartoons that complement its coverage of global affairs.

Where are the suitable places to publish political cartoons?
Some newspapers and magazines also accept political cartoons. For example, The New Yorker or satirical publications. However, they usually have specific submission guidelines and requirements. Another option is to create your own website or blog to showcase your work and build a following.

What kind of political cartoons does the New York Times publish?
The New York Times' political cartoons are known for their thought-provoking nature. They may highlight controversial topics, offer critical insights, or use humor to draw attention to important political developments. The range is quite broad and depends on the news cycle and editorial decisions.

Is it dangerous to publish a fictional story about a political situation?
It could be dangerous. If the story portrays the political situation inaccurately or in a way that offends certain groups, there could be negative consequences. Also, some countries have strict laws regarding political content in fictional works.

What are political cartoons?
Political cartoons are visual representations that use humor, satire, or commentary to express opinions or critique political situations and figures.

Are political cartoons accurate?
In many cases, political cartoons can be accurate as they often capture the main points and sentiments of a situation. However, they might use satire or symbolism to make their point, which could be interpreted differently by different people.

Are political cartoons true?
Political cartoons often present a caricatured or exaggerated view of a situation, so they might not be strictly 'true' in a literal sense. They use satire and humor to make a point.

Are political cartoons allegorical?
Yes, political cartoons often are allegorical. They use symbolic and metaphorical elements to convey complex political ideas or commentaries in a simplified and visually engaging way.
